Fishing for Common seadragon

Phyllopteryx taeniolatus

The common seadragon, also known as the weedy seadragon, is a marine fish featuring leaf-like appendages that provide excellent camouflage. Native to the coastal waters of southern Australia, it grows up to 18 inches in length. This species is known for its slow, graceful swimming and feeds primarily on small crustaceans, blending seamlessly with seaweed and kelp in its environment. This summary is AI generated
